What Are Hydraulic Pumps?
At their core, hydraulic pumps are devices that convert mechanical energy into hydraulic energy by moving fluid through a hydraulic circuit. They are crucial components in numerous machinery and applications, enabling the operation of various systems through fluid power.
The Role of Hydraulic Pumps in Auto Parts & Supplies
In the automotive industry, hydraulic pumps play a significant role in a variety of systems, including:
- Power Steering Systems: Hydraulic pumps assist drivers in steering by providing necessary force, making steering easier and more responsive.
- Braking Systems: Hydraulic pumps enable the transfer of force from the brake pedal to the brake components, ensuring effective stopping power.
- Transmission Systems: In automatic vehicles, hydraulic pumps facilitate smooth gear transitions by providing pressure to engage and disengage gears.
- Suspension Systems: These pumps help adjust the vehicle's ride height and comfort by distributing fluid to various suspension components.

Exploring the Different Types of Hydraulic Pumps
There are various types of hydraulic pumps, each suited for different applications and requirements. Understanding these types can help you choose the best pump for your vehicle:
- Gear Pumps: Known for their high efficiency, gear pumps use interlocking gears to move fluid. They are widely used in various automotive applications.
- Vane Pumps: Featuring sliding vanes within a rotor, vane pumps are excellent for providing smooth and consistent flow in hydraulic systems.
- Plunger Pumps: These pumps generate high pressures and are ideal for applications requiring significant force.
- Diaphragm Pumps: Utilizing a diaphragm to separate the pumping chamber, diaphragm pumps are typically used where non-contaminated fluid transfer is essential.
Maintenance Tips for Hydraulic Pumps
Proper maintenance of hydraulic pumps is essential in ensuring their longevity and optimal performance. Here are some vital maintenance tips:
- Regular Inspections: Frequent checks help identify potential issues before they become major problems.
- Fluid Quality: Always use high-quality hydraulic fluid and regularly check its attributes. Contaminated fluid can cause pump failure.
- Monitor Temperature: Excessive heat can damage hydraulic pumps; keep an eye on the operating temperature to ensure components remain within safe limits.
- Check for Leaks: Any sign of leakage should be promptly addressed to prevent operational issues.
